Mert Susur
Aug 24, 2017 · 1 min read

Sanirim bir yanlis anlasilma olmus orada Mahmut, Redux her seferinde “deep clone” yaparak yeni nesneyi saklamiyor. Her degisiklikte sadece degisen kisim saklaniyor, mesela 100 elemanli bir dizide iki eleman degisirse sadece o iki elemanin referansi degisiyor ve array kopyalaniyor. Referanslari ayni kalanlar tekrar hafizada yer kaplamiyor.

Diger taraftan gercekten saklaman gereken nesneleri Redux Store’ye atman gerekiyor. Yani uygulamanin durumunu ifade eden nesneler disindaki nesneleri component’lerin kendi local state’lerinde tutman daha saglikli. Yoksa uygulamana yersiz bir karmasiklik getirirsin.

)

    Mert Susur

    Written by

    I do stuff. with code.